CBD has been shown in studies to improve weight loss by altering the metabolism. CBD works by altering the fat cells of the body. There are two types if fat cells in the human body: brown and a white one. The white cells store fat under the skin and in your abdominal cavity. The brown cells are sparser and are located in the spine and shoulder blades. Brown fat cells can help you lose weight and reduce calories.
It isn't clear whether CBD products can be used for weight loss. While limited research supports CBD's weight loss potential, some studies show that CBD has increased weight loss in animals. This suggests that CBD could work on certain receptors in your body to speed up metabolism and reduce food intake. Further research is necessary to confirm this claim.

Can I use CBD during pregnancy?
There isn’t enough research available to confirm that CBD is safe to be used during pregnancy.
It is not possible to prove that CBD causes harm to the baby, based on what little information there is.
Pregnant mothers should not consume CBD unless it is recommended by their doctor.
In fact, the Food and Drug Administration issued a warning last week about the potential dangers of CBD taking while pregnant.
According to the FDA, "there is some evidence that cannabis use during pregnancy may increase the risk of miscarriage."
According to the agency further research is required before any firm conclusions can be reached.

How big is the global CBD market?
Euromonitor International estimated that the global CBD industry was worth $US3.5 billion in 2015. This represents a 10% increase from 2014.
The report forecasts this figure to reach $US 6.4 billion by 2020, representing an average annual growth rate of 12%.
CBD products are expected to account for around half of all hemp-derived products sold globally by 2020.
This includes CBD oils, as well other CBD products, including food, beverages cosmetics, pet care, and CBD oils.
